About This Webinar

Schools collect more data than ever before, but too often, it creates noise rather than clarity. Teachers are left navigating spreadsheets, leaders struggle to turn numbers into action, and the focus drifts away from what matters most: improving outcomes for students.

In this webinar, Alps Education explores what teachers and school leaders actually need from a student progress tracking system, and how schools can move from data overload to meaningful, confident decision-making.

Drawing on over 20 years of experience working with schools, colleges, MATs and international settings, we’ll unpack the five features that matter most when it comes to tracking progress effectively.

We’ll look beyond raw attainment data to explore how progress, value added and wider contextual information can be combined to create insights that genuinely support teaching, learning and leadership.

Whether you’re a classroom teacher, middle leader, senior leader or trust-level colleague, this webinar is designed to help you reflect on your current approach to tracking progress - and consider what “good” really looks like in your context.
